Ep. 112: What happens when ideas become harder and harder to find — Political Economy Podcast with James Pethokoukis
Just to maintain our current overall rate of economic growth, the economy has to double its research efforts every 13 years -- at least according to Stanford economist Nicholas Bloom. He joins me to discuss the implications of his research, his recent work on economic uncertainty, and much more.
